BACKGROUND eHealth and Telehealth play a crucial role in assisting older adults who visit hospitals frequently or who live in nursing homes and can benefit from staying at home while being cared for. Adapting to new technologies can be difficult for older people. Thus, to better apply these technologies to older adults’ lives, many studies have analyzed acceptance factors for this particular population. However, there is not yet a consensual framework to be used in further development and the search for solutions. OBJECTIVE This paper presents an Integrated Acceptance Framework (IAF) for the older user’s acceptance of eHealth, based on 43 studies selected through a systematic review. METHODS We conducted a four-step study. First, through a systematic review from 2010 to 2020 in the field of eHealth, the acceptance factors and basic data for analysis were extracted. Second, we carried out a thematic analysis to group the factors into themes to propose and integrated framework for acceptance. Third, we defined a metric to evaluate the impact of the factors addressed in the studies. Last, the differences amongst the important IAF factors were analyzed, according to the participants’ health conditions, verification time, and year. RESULTS Through the systematic review, 731 studies were founded in 5 major databases, resulting in 43 selected studies using the PRISMA methodology. First, the research methods and the acceptance factors for eHealth were compared and analyzed, extracting a total of 105 acceptance factors, which were grouped later, resulting in the Integrated Acceptance Framework. Five dimensions (i.e., personal, user-technology relational, technological, service-related, environmental) emerged with a total of 23 factors. Also, we assessed the quality of the evidence. And then, we conducted a stratification analysis to reveal the more appropriate factors depending on the health condition and the assessment time. Finally, we assess which are the factors and dimensions that are recently becoming more important. CONCLUSIONS The result of this investigation is a framework for conducting research on eHealth acceptance. To elaborately analyze the impact of the factors of the proposed framework, the criteria for evaluating the evidence from the studies that have extracted factors are presented. Through this process, the impact of each factor in the IAF has been presented, in addition to the framework proposal. Moreover, a meta-analysis of the current status of research is presented, highlighting the areas where specific measures are needed to facilitate e-Health acceptance.

Abstract Abstract Background and Objectives There is considerable heterogeneity in experiences of aging, with some experiencing greater well-being and adapting more successfully to the challenges of aging than others. Self-compassion is a modifiable psychological skill that might help explain individual differences in well-being and adjustment in later life. The aim of this study was to systematically review the literature on self-compassion and well-being outcomes in studies of older adults aged 65 and older. Research Design and Methods This systematic review was conducted according to PRISMA guidelines, using databases PsycINFO, Medline, and Embase. The search term self-compassion was paired with terms relating to well-being, psychological symptoms, and adjustment. Meta-analysis was used to synthesize results on the relationship between self-compassion and four outcomes including depression, anxiety, hedonic well-being, and eudaimonic well-being. Results Eleven studies met inclusion criteria for this review. Meta-analysis revealed that self-compassion was associated with lower levels of depression (r = −.58, 95% CI [−.66, −.48]) and anxiety (r = −.36, 95% CI [−.60, −.07]), and higher levels of hedonic (r = .41, 95% CI [.15, .62]) and eudaimonic (r = .49, 95% CI [.41, .57]) well-being. Further, three studies found self-compassion weakened the impact of physical symptoms on well-being outcomes. Discussion and Implications We found preliminary evidence that self-compassion is associated with well-being outcomes in older adults, and that self-compassion may buffer the psychological sequelae of health symptoms in later life. Higher quality studies with uniform outcome measures are needed to replicate and extend these results.

ABSTRACT Protein supplementation is an attractive strategy to prevent loss of muscle mass in older adults. However, it could be counterproductive due to adverse effects on appetite. This systematic review and meta-analysis aimed to determine the effects of protein supplementation on appetite and/or energy intake (EI) in healthy older adults. MEDLINE, The Cochrane Library, CINAHL, and Web of Science were searched up to June 2020. Acute and longitudinal studies in healthy adults ≥60 y of age that reported effects of protein supplementation (through supplements or whole foods) compared with control and/or preintervention (for longitudinal studies) on appetite ratings, appetite-related peptides, and/or EI were included. Random-effects model meta-analysis was performed on EI, with other outcomes qualitatively reviewed. Twenty-two studies (9 acute, 13 longitudinal) were included, involving 857 participants (331 males, 526 females). In acute studies (n = 8), appetite ratings were suppressed in 7 out of 24 protein arms. For acute studies reporting EI (n = 7, n = 22 protein arms), test meal EI was reduced following protein preload compared with control [mean difference (MD): −164 kJ; 95% CI: −299, −29 kJ; P  = 0.02]. However, when energy content of the supplement was accounted for, total EI was greater with protein compared with control (MD: 649 kJ; 95% CI: 438, 861 kJ; P < 0.00001). Longitudinal studies (n = 12 protein arms) showed a higher protein intake (MD: 0.29 g ⋅ kg−1 ⋅ d−1; 95% CI: 0.14, 0.45 g ⋅ kg−1 ⋅ d−1; P < 0.001) and no difference in daily EI between protein and control groups at the end of trials (MD: −54 kJ/d; 95% CI: −300, 193 kJ/d; P  = 0.67). While appetite ratings may be suppressed with acute protein supplementation, there is either a positive effect or no effect on total EI in acute and longitudinal studies, respectively. Therefore, protein supplementation may represent an effective solution to increase protein intakes in healthy older adults without compromising EI through appetite suppression. Background. Senescence refers to spontaneous and progressive irreversible degenerative changes in which both the physical and psychological power diminish significantly. Hypertension is the most common cardiovascular disease in the elderly. Several studies have been conducted regarding the effect of exercise on reducing the blood pressure of the elderly, which have found contradictory results. One of the uses of meta-analysis study is responding to these assumptions and resolving the discrepancies. Accordingly, the aim of the present study is to determine the impact of exercise on the blood pressure of older adults. Method. In this research, in order to find electronic published papers from 1992 to 2019, the papers published in both domestic and foreign databases including SID, MagIran, IranMedex, IranDox, Gogole Scholar, Cohrane, Embase, Science Direct, Scopus, PubMed, and Web of Science (ISI) were used. Heterogeneity index between the studies was determined based on Cochran test Q(c) and I2. Considering existence of heterogeneity, random effects model was employed to estimate the standardized subtraction of the mean exercise test score for reduction of blood pressure in the older adults across the intervention group before and after the test. Results. In this meta-analysis and systematic review, eventually 69 papers met the inclusion criteria. The total number of participants was 2272 in the pre- and postintervention groups when examining the systolic changes and 2252 subjects in the pre- and postintervention groups when inspecting the diastolic changes. The standardized mean difference in examining the systolic changes before the intervention was 137.1 ± 8.09 and 132.98 ± 0.96 after the intervention; when exploring the diastolic changes, the pre- and postintervention values were 80.3 ± 0.85 and 76.0 ± 6.56, respectively, where these differences were statistically significant (P<0.01). Conclusion. The results of this study indicated that exercise leads to significant reduction in both systolic and diastolic blood pressure. Accordingly, regular exercise can be part of the treatment plan for hypertensive elderly.

Physical activity is an important determinant of health in later life. The public health restrictions in response to COVID-19 have interrupted habitual physical activity behaviours in older adults. In response, numerous exercise programmes have been developed for older adults, many involving chair-based exercise. The aim of this systematic review was to synthesise the effects of chair-based exercise on the health of older adults. Ovid Medline, EMBASE, CINAHL, AMED, PyscInfo and SPORTDiscus databases were searched from inception to 1 April 2020. Chair-based exercise programmes in adults ≥50 years, lasting for at least 2 weeks and measuring the impact on physical function were included. Risk of bias of included studies were assessed using Cochrane risk of bias tool v2. Intervention content was described using TiDieR Criteria. Where sufficient studies (≥3 studies) reported data on an outcome, a random effects meta-analysis was performed. In total, 25 studies were included, with 19 studies in the meta-analyses. Seventeen studies had a low risk of bias and five had a high risk of bias. In this systematic review including 1388 participants, results demonstrated that chair-based exercise programmes improve upper extremity (handgrip strength: MD = 2.10; 95% CI = 0.76, 3.43 and 30 s arm curl test: MD = 2.82; 95% CI = 1.34, 4.31) and lower extremity function (30 s chair stand: MD 2.25; 95% CI = 0.64, 3.86). The findings suggest that chair-based exercises are effective and should be promoted as simple and easily implemented activities to maintain and develop strength for older adults.

Background: Unintentional weight loss is a hallmark of frailty and is associated with poor outcomes in older adults with type 2 diabetes. As such, the role of pharmacological therapies that facilitate weight loss – namely, sodium- glucose co-transporter-2 (SGLT-2) inhibitors and glucagon-like peptide-1 (GLP-1) receptor agonists – remains uncertain in fitter older adults. We performed a systematic review and meta-analysis to evaluate these agents on major adverse cardiovascular events (MACE) in older adults eligible for participation in cardiovascular outcome trials.Methods: A literature search was performed in MEDLINE, EMBASE, CINAHL, Cochrane Central Registry of Controlled Trials (CENTRAL) and CNKI from inception to 29 June 2020. A class-specific meta-analysis was conducted in older adults (>65 years at recruitment) and compared with the similar analysis in younger (<65 years) adults.Results: Of 761 unique studies identified, nine met the criteria for inclusion, five using GLP-1 receptor agonists and four with SGLT-2 inhibitors. GLP-1 receptor agonists in older adults were associated with a 15.3% (OR 0.847 (95% CI 0.788 to 0.910)) reduction in MACE events, similar to the 16% benefit seen in younger adults. The use of SGLT-2 inhibitors reduced MACE in older participants by 16.9% (OR 0.831 (95% CI 0.699 to 0.989)), numerically superior to the impact in younger patients (OR 0.936 (95% CI 0.787 to 1.113).Conclusions: GLP-1 receptor agonists and SGLT-2 inhibitors reduced MACE outcomes in older adults who were eligible to participate in clinical trials. Whereas this is reassuring for the biologically robust, it should not be extrapolated to frail older adults without further investigation.

Background Trauma-focused treatments (TFTs) have demonstrated efficacy at decreasing depressive symptoms in individuals with PTSD. This systematic review and meta-analysis evaluated the effectiveness of TFTs for individuals with depression as their primary concern. Methods A systematic search was conducted for RCTs published before October 2019 in Cochrane CENTRAL, Pubmed, EMBASE, PsycInfo, and additional sources. Trials examining the impact of TFTs on participants with depression were included. Trials focusing on individuals with PTSD or another mental health condition were excluded. The primary outcome was the effect size for depression diagnosis or depressive symptoms. Heterogeneity, study quality, and publication bias were also explored. Results Eleven RCTs were included (n = 567) with ten of these using EMDR as the TFT and one using imagery rescripting. Analysis suggested these TFTs were effective in reducing depressive symptoms post-treatment with a large effect size [d = 1.17 (95% CI: 0.58~ 1.75)]. Removal of an outlier saw the effect size remain large [d = 0.83 (95% CI: 0.48~ 1.17)], while the heterogeneity decreased (I2 = 66%). Analysis of the 10 studies that used EMDR also showed a large effect [d = 1.30 (95% CI: 0.67~1.91)]. EMDR was superior to non trauma-focused CBT [d = 0.66 (95% CI: 0.31~1.02)] and analysis of EMDR and imagery rescripting studies suggest superiority over inactive control conditions [d = 1.19 (95% CI: 0.53~ 1.86)]. Analysis of follow-up data also supported the use of EMDR with this population [d = 0.71 (95% CI: 1.04~0.38)]. No publication bias was identified. Conclusions Current evidence suggests that EMDR can be an effective treatment for depression. There were insufficient RCTs on other trauma-focused interventions to conclude whether TFTs in general were effective for treating depression. Larger studies with robust methodology using EMDR and other trauma-focused interventions are needed to build on these findings.
